question using generator power

We have a 30ft jayco motorhome and have used it a number of times but never used the generator for power. We have started it up for checks but never relied on it. We are doing a trip soon and was going over the motorhome and when I started up the generator I was thinking that I could plug things in and I would have power to those plugs as if I was plugged into a main source of power ie: campground. I don't. I know that it is most likely something stupid that I'm either not doing or should do but don't know what to do. Should it be automatic that when the generator is on - inverter on that I should have power coming to the plugs thoughout the motorhome. Sorry for the stupid question but any advise would be greatly appreciated.

There is a circuit breaker on the front of the geny next to the start prime button(under the cover) looks like a regular switch, it may be off.

Your inverter probably only powers the front TV.

yes the front tv is working and the ceiling lights but not the microwave or any of the plugs. Last year we had the rv disconnect battery relay solenoid switch changed by an rv dealer; when they were installing it it looked different than the original one - could not make a difference; the original one had a fuse on each side - one 7.5 and the other 5 this new one only has the one fuse? I will check the circuit breaker on the front of the geny; question would the geny start if that circuit breaker was off? thanks for all your help it is greatly appreciated.

Nothing but the front TV is wired to the inverter. The geny powers everything including the front TV and yes the geny will start if that breaker is off just no 110 output. Ceiling lights are 12 volt.
